The Macdonald Marine Hotel has recently re-opened after a £13.5 million investment. All 83 bedrooms and public areas have been fully refurbished. Picturesquely located at the heart of the East Lothian golfing-coast, The Marine Hotel overlooks the 16th hole of North Berwick's championship links. Standing in landscaped grounds in the harbour town and encompassing superb views of the breathtaking Firth of Forth, the Marine Hotel's Victorian facade conceals a wealth of creature comforts and delights to be discovered. The Marine Hotel offers guests 83 well-appointed, individually decorated en-suite guestrooms, including six four-posters, five suites and four mini-suites. Each provides guests with a range of facilities and golf aficionados should opt for one of the rooms offering views over the sea and golf course. The Craigleith Restaurant is renowned for its superb Scottish and international menu, while the 19th Hole Bar is a favourite haunt of visitors and locals alike.
